2021 Foraging Fortnight

Lodged by Karen Adam (Scottish National Party) Standard Motion 12 supporters

The motion

That the Parliament recognises 2021 Foraging Fortnight, which is a celebration of Scotland's natural environment and wild food and runs from 11 to 25 September; notes that it offers a blend of virtual and in-person outdoor events on a variety of subjects, including wild food treks and coastal foraging, workshops on herbal wellness and seminars on food policy; notes that wild foraging can have a positive impact on both physical and mental health by offering an affordable opportunity for people to get fresh air and exercise while engaging with nature to find free and healthy food that enhances overall wellbeing, and commends the organisers for providing foraging guides for children and adults in both English and Gaelic and for highlighting the importance of following responsible guidelines that prioritise safety and sustainability, ensuring that visitors and the community can enjoy Scotland's rural landscape for years to come.
